Finance Review Summary — FY Headcount Plan

To branch managers: Next year's plan approved at 412 heads, up 6%. Growth concentrated in the Ostrem and Vane Hollow branches; the Pellister branch holds flat. Backfill freeze lifts in Q2. Contractor spend capped at 9% of payroll. Requests above plan route through Finance Director Ilsa Brann. Recruitment budgets release monthly, not quarterly, starting January. Rationale for the weighting is set out in the note below.

confidential, yajof-fadug: Project Julvan slips by one quarter because of the audit delay.

**Level 6 Opening — Contractor Access (Brantley Court)**

Level 6 opens Monday. Contractors use the goods lift only. Sign in at the loading dock, wear hi-vis at all times, and keep the fire corridor clear. Tools must not be left overnight without a stores tag. The stairwell door to level 6 remains locked during fit-out; enter using the door code provided below.

badge for fafop-fajof: bdg-Z-47

MINUTES — Management Meeting, Finance Team

Present: Dorvan, Leitch, Amsel. Topic: shift to annual billing for the Cloverline subscription tier. Agreed: pilot with top 40 accounts in Q3. Dorvan to model discount bands; Leitch to draft dunning changes; Amsel to brief collections. Churn risk flagged but deemed acceptable. Next review in four weeks. Rationale for timing is summarized in the note below.

confidential, yawif-fadup: The southern region missed its Eliius quota by 61.1 percent last quarter. Istixax Freight plans to raise the Jorwyn list price by 65.7 percent in October. The board signed off on a budget of $445.3 million for Project Ulaox. The renewal with Briathax Partners closes at $41.0 million a year, 49.9 percent below the last contract.